Early Harvest Markers

Early Harvest Markers refer to phenotypic and developmental traits breeders select for to identify cannabis plants that mature faster than standard timelines. These indicators—including leaf morphology changes, pistil coloration patterns, and flowering node density—allow cultivators to predict harvest readiness weeks in advance. Lineage records from breeders working in rapid-cycling categories frequently report Afghan, Thai, and Mexican landrace ancestry as foundational genetics for accelerated maturation. Early markers are valued in breeding programs targeting shorter growing seasons, commercial turnover, and climate-adaptive cultivars. Documentation of these traits helps standardize seed selection across generations.

Breeder relevance

Breeders routinely cross early-maturing parent lines to concentrate fast-finishing traits in F1 and F2 generations. Selection for visible pre-harvest markers reduces guesswork in commercial and home cultivation, improving crop planning and genetic stability within breeding lines.
